§1.2PICO frame

Table 1. The registered PICO frame. Any change made after protocol registration is recorded in the amendment log at §5 and is identified there as post hoc.

ElementAs registered
PopulationA disorder of glucose regulation characterised by insulin resistance with relative insulin deficiency, diagnosed by glycated haemoglobin, fasting plasma glucose or oral glucose tolerance criteria.
InterventionLixisenatide administered as subcutaneous once daily before the first meal of the day.
ComparatorThe comparator used in each contributing trial, reported per trial rather than pooled across comparator types.
OutcomesAnchor outcome for this indication: Change in HbA1c (%, mmol/mol). Additional outcomes: Proportion achieving HbA1c <7.0 % and ≤6.5 %; Change in fasting serum glucose; Change in body weight.

§1.4Conclusion

High certainty evidence bears on whether the effect of Lixisenatide in type 2 diabetes mellitus is maintained across the randomised period. The contributing trials range in duration and the Institute reports the trajectory per trial rather than pooling across durations, because a mean at 36 weeks and a mean at 104 weeks are not estimates of the same quantity.

The conclusion rests on 4 contributing studies, listed with their extracted data at §3 and summarised outcome by outcome at §4.
